Test plan: Fareloom shipping-fee rules engine, sprint 14.

Cover: flat-rate fallback, weight-tier boundaries (exact edge values), regional surcharges for the Tolvane zone, and rule-priority conflicts. Run the full matrix against the sandbox tenant, not prod. Expected outputs live in fees_expected.csv; diffs over $0.01 are failures. Log anomalies in the tracker, not email. Sandbox calls need auth — use the bearer token below.

bearer token for tawig-bahif: eyJhbGciOiJIUzI1NiIsInR5cCI6IkpXVCJ9.eyJzdWIiOiIo-yiO33jvEIn0.T9qLInSAqhTN

# Glyphboard Editor: Undo/Redo Limits

Plugin authors: undo history in Glyphboard is bounded per document, and plugin-generated mutations count against the same budget as user edits. Batched mutations collapse into one history entry, so prefer batching. Exceeding the snapshot size limit silently truncates older entries. The enforced limits and related tuning constants are shown below.

tuning constants:
QUOTAS = {
    "druwyn": 5,
    "holix": 5,
    "zorath": 5,
    "holwyn": 10,
}

Dear contractors,

The Fennelmoor Building loading dock accepts deliveries strictly between 07:30 and 11:00 on weekdays. Outside these hours the roller door is locked and unattended, and drivers will be turned away. Please schedule all material drops accordingly and allow fifteen minutes for marshalling. Oversized loads need advance notice of two working days. To open the pedestrian side door during dock hours, enter the code below at the keypad.

Kind regards,
Front Desk, Fennelmoor Building

staff pass of kawip-hawef = bdg-QLP-2

14:22 — This is where it got weird. The Liftwise dispatch simulator started assigning every car to floor 9 because the weighting function divided by pending-call count, which hit zero after the cache flush. Real dispatch was fine; only the sim misbehaved, but it fed bad forecasts to capacity planning for about forty minutes. Harriet patched the divisor with a floor of one and reran the night's scenarios. The patched simulator build is identified by the token below.

session token of taweg-kawep = htk9_60875cecd